    Stop fuel leak in helicopter?

    This is false. Thanks to vehicles not saving in 1.7.2.5 and consistently respawning at their "initial" spawn location, I've easily been able to repair 3 helicopters in the past week. I can confirm that when you've repaired EVERYTHING, the fuel leak stops. This means: 1x Main Rotor Assembly 1x Engine Parts 4x Scrap Metal 8x Windscreen Glass Make sure you SCROLL DOWN on the repair menus for scrap/glass since there are more than what just shows up on the initial view of the action menu. The HUD in the helicopter DOES NOT show the status of all scrap metal repairable parts nor does it show the status of the windscreen repairs. So, the HUD showing "all green" means nothing at all when it comes to the helicopter being fully repaired to the point of no longer leaking fuel. Again, I've repaired 3 helicopters in the past week and can confirm they do leak like hell UNTIL fully repaired. Then, the fuel lasts forever it seems ;)

  24. I'm with OP on this one. Zed's speed is still ridiculous and the only way to lose them is to run through a building, up ther hill, down a slope or just shoot them. Reducing zed's speed makes the animations less buggy and actually hitting them a bit less pain in the ass. Of course you can't just reduce zed's speed and just call it a day. You'll have to tweak the whole system to get it work right. First of make zed's punching animation reach a lot further and not to make them stop in their tracks (I know they sometimesdo this run by hit but you can still safely run away from them). Second thing is to make zed's more slow, maybe just a little bit faster than player running with W pressed, but still lower than player using double tapped W to sprint. Thridly introduce exhaustion when sprinting (note this would only affect double tapping sprint so you could still travel by foot). Also make sprinting bit faster and normal running just a little bit slower to create more difference between them. So in conclusion we would have a system where the sprinting (double tapping W) would be only used in life threatening situations like zed chasing you. You could out run it for a while, maybe even get enough distance to hide, but you could only keep on sprinting for a minute or so and your aim would shake extemely for next 20 seconds making aiming really hard. Also zeds would gain you slowly if you would only run (one press of W) but a less slower rate than currently. Running would still be unlimited to allow people lacking vehicles to travel across Chernarus.
